What’s the difference between a trade show and a conference?
A conference is primarily focused on presentations and discussions, where speakers share ideas, research and insights with an audience. A trade show, on the other hand, is focused on doing business. Companies exhibit their products, services and solutions, allowing buyers and decision-makers to meet suppliers, compare technologies, build partnerships and make purchasing decisions. Events like Sustainability Business Live combine both formats — offering high-level conference sessions alongside a large exhibition floor where real business takes place.
